새 도메인 기반 DFS(분산 파일 시스템) 네임스페이스를 만듭니다. 네임스페이스가 이미 있는 경우 함수는 지정된 루트 대상을 추가합니다.
구문
NET_API_STATUS NET_API_FUNCTION NetDfsAddFtRoot(
[in] LPWSTR ServerName,
[in] LPWSTR RootShare,
[in] LPWSTR FtDfsName,
[in, optional] LPWSTR Comment,
[in] DWORD Flags
);
매개 변수
[in] ServerName
새 DFS 루트 대상을 호스트할 서버의 이름을 지정하는 문자열에 대한 포인터입니다. 이 값은 IP 주소일 수 없습니다. 이 매개 변수는 필수입니다.
[in] RootShare
새 DFS 루트 대상을 호스트할 서버의 공유 폴더 이름을 지정하는 문자열에 대한 포인터입니다. 이 매개 변수는 필수입니다.
[in] FtDfsName
새 도메인 기반 또는 기존 도메인 기반 DFS 네임스페이스의 이름을 지정하는 문자열에 대한 포인터입니다. 이 매개 변수는 필수입니다. 호환성을 위해 RootShare 매개 변수와 동일한 문자열을 지정해야 합니다.
[in, optional] Comment
DFS 네임스페이스와 연결된 선택적 주석이 포함된 문자열에 대한 포인터입니다.
[in] Flags
이 매개 변수는 예약되어 있으며 0이어야 합니다.
반환 값
함수가 성공하면 반환 값이 NERR_Success.
함수가 실패하면 반환 값은 시스템 오류 코드입니다. 오류 코드 목록은 시스템 오류 코드를 참조하세요.
설명
RootShare 매개 변수로 지정된 공유는 새 DFS 루트 대상을 호스트할 서버에 이미 있어야 합니다. 이 함수는 새 공유를 만들지 않습니다.
호출자는 디렉터리 서비스에서 DFS 컨테이너를 업데이트할 수 있는 권한이 있어야 하며 DFS 호스트(루트) 서버에 대한 관리자 권한이 있어야 합니다.
요구 사항
| 지원되는 최소 클라이언트 | Windows Vista |
| 지원되는 최소 서버 | Windows Server 2008 |
| 대상 플랫폼 | Windows |
| 헤더 | lmdfs.h(LmDfs.h, Lm.h 포함) |
| 라이브러리 | Netapi32.lib |
| DLL | Netapi32.dll |